What companies run services between Leros, Greece and Lesbos, Greece?

Olympic Air and Aegean Airlines fly from Leros Municipal Airport (LRS) to Mytilene International Airport Odysseas Elytis (MJT) twice daily. Alternatively, Blue Star Ferries operates a ferry from Leros to Mytilene 4 times a week. Tickets cost €60–140 and the journey takes 9h 15m.
